Released in 2015, *The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t* by CD Projekt Red redefined what an open-world RPG could be. Starring the stoic monster hunter Geralt of Rivia, the game boasts a vast, breathtaking world teeming with life, lore, and morally ambiguous choices. Its narrative is masterfully crafted, weaving personal stakes with grand political intrigue, making every side quest feel as significant as the main story.
The combat is fluid and engaging, the character development is rich, and the sheer scale of content is astounding. It won numerous Game of the Year awards and is often cited as a benchmark for modern RPGs, cementing its place as one of the definitive Rpgs All Time. The attention to detail in its world-building and character interactions is unparalleled, offering an immersive experience that few games can match.

Square Enix’s *Final Fantasy VII*, originally released in 1997, is more than just a game; it’s a cultural phenomenon. Its groundbreaking 3D graphics, mature storytelling, and unforgettable characters like Cloud Strife and Sephiroth captivated a generation. The game tackled themes of environmentalism, corporate greed, and identity with a depth rarely seen in video games at the time.
The Materia system offered unparalleled customization, and its turn-based combat was both strategic and visually spectacular. *Final Fantasy VII* didn’t just popularize JRPGs in the West; it became synonymous with the genre’s potential for epic narratives and emotional impact, making it an undeniable entry among the Rpgs All Time. Its influence can be seen across countless subsequent titles, proving its lasting power.

Bethesda Game Studios unleashed *The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im* upon the world in 2011, and it quickly became a cultural touchstone. Its immense open world, filled with dragons, ancient ruins, and endless quests, offered unprecedented freedom and exploration. Players could be anyone and do anything, from saving the world as the Dragonborn to simply living a quiet life in a remote village.
The game’s modding community has extended its life for over a decade, constantly adding new content and experiences. *Skyrim*’s impact on open-world design and player-driven narratives is immense, solidifying its status as one of the most influential Rpgs All Time. BioWare’s *Mass Effect 2*, released in 2010, is often lauded as the pinnacle of the action RPG genre and a shining example of interactive storytelling. As Commander Shepard, players assembled a diverse crew of alien and human specialists for a suicide mission to save the galaxy. The game masterfully blended intense third-person shooter combat with deep character development and impactful choices.
Its strength lay in its unforgettable characters and the relationships forged with them, making every decision feel weighty and personal. The loyalty missions, in particular, are legendary for their narrative depth and emotional resonance. *Mass Effect 2* proved that RPGs could deliver cinematic experiences without sacrificing player agency, earning its spot among the most beloved Rpgs All Time. Developed by an all-star team at Square (dubbed the “Dream Team”), *Chrono Trigger* (1995) is a masterpiece of the 16-bit era. Its innovative time-traveling narrative, which sees players jumping through different historical periods to prevent an apocalypse, was revolutionary. The multiple endings, determined by player choices, added immense replay value and narrative complexity.
Its unique “Active Dimension Battle” system seamlessly integrated enemies into the environment, eschewing random encounters. Combined with its memorable Akira Toriyama character designs and Yasunori Mitsuda’s iconic soundtrack, *Chrono Trigger* remains a gold standard for JRPGs and one of the most creatively brilliant Rpgs All Time. Its innovative approach to time travel set a high bar for narrative design.

Black Isle Studios’ *Planescape: Torment*, released in 1999, is unlike any other RPG. Set in the bizarre and philosophical Dungeons & Dragons Planescape universe, it prioritizes story, dialogue, and character development above all else. Players control the Nameless One, an immortal being with amnesia, on a quest to uncover his past and the meaning of his existence.
The game is renowned for its incredibly rich writing, complex moral dilemmas, and unforgettable companions. Combat is secondary to conversation, and many challenges can be overcome through clever dialogue choices. *Planescape: Torment* is a profound, thought-provoking experience that showcases the genre’s capacity for deep philosophical exploration, making it a unique and powerful entry among the Rpgs All Time. FromSoftware’s *Dark Souls* (2011) spawned a subgenre and redefined difficulty in action RPGs. Set in the desolate, interconnected world of Lordran, the game challenges players with brutal combat, formidable bosses, and a minimalist, environmental storytelling approach. Its “prepare to die” mantra became infamous, but beneath the difficulty lay a deeply rewarding experience.
The satisfaction of overcoming seemingly insurmountable odds, combined with its intricate level design and cryptic lore, created a cult following. *Dark Souls* proved that challenging games could still be immensely popular and influential, solidifying its place as one of the most impactful Rpgs All Time. It pushed players to master its mechanics and explore its rich, melancholic world.

BioWare’s *Baldur’s Gate II: Shadows of Amn* (2000) is often considered the pinnacle of isometric, Dungeons & Dragons-based RPGs. Building upon its acclaimed predecessor, BG2 offered an incredibly rich world, a sprawling narrative, and a cast of some of the most memorable companions in gaming history. Players embarked on an epic quest through the Forgotten Realms, making critical decisions that shaped their destiny.
Its deep character customization, tactical real-time-with-pause combat, and immense replayability made it a favorite among hardcore RPG fans. The sheer amount of content, coupled with its engaging story and complex moral choices, ensures *Baldur’s Gate II* remains a towering achievement and a definitive entry among the Rpgs All Time. Developed by Obsidian Entertainment, *Fallout: New Vegas* (2010) is celebrated for its unparalleled player agency and branching narrative. Set in a post-apocalyptic Mojave Wasteland, players navigate a complex political landscape between warring factions, with nearly every choice having tangible consequences on the game world and its inhabitants. Its writing is sharp, witty, and often darkly humorous.
The game excelled in its role-playing mechanics, allowing players to truly craft their character and influence the story through dialogue, skills, and allegiances. While often overshadowed by *Skyrim*’s commercial success, *New Vegas* is revered by many for its superior storytelling and choice-and-consequence systems, earning its place as one of the most respected Rpgs All Time. Its dedication to player freedom is a core strength.

Atlus’s *Persona 5 Royal* (2019, an enhanced version of the 2016 original) is a stylish, emotionally resonant JRPG that blends high school life simulation with dungeon crawling. Players take on the role of Joker, a transfer student who gains the power to enter the cognitive worlds of corrupt adults, stealing their distorted desires as the “Phantom Thieves of Hearts.”
The game is a masterclass in aesthetic design, with a vibrant art style, an incredible acid-jazz soundtrack, and slick UI. Its engaging story tackles themes of social injustice, rebellion, and self-discovery, all while balancing daily life activities with turn-based combat. *Persona 5 Royal* represents the pinnacle of modern JRPG design, offering hundreds of hours of captivating gameplay and undeniable charm, making it a standout among the Rpgs All Time.
